Output e27d59e4614caa925312341181f0cc2cba59ab882956727089e6bf6b84321b96:7

value
2930094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3088cdb7b45be3801541dec962a873dcd14fe9 OP_EQUAL
address
3L86ZXE9PvJLLn7J1PsrP5YLSJdSzMtgEJ
transaction
e27d59e4614caa925312341181f0cc2cba59ab882956727089e6bf6b84321b96
spent
true